I have had costochondritis for about two years, but only had it diagnosed a week ago. I was told there was no cure, so I have been extremely frustrated, because the pain can be really awful. I have been applying heat but it hasn't had much effect. HOWEVER, this morning, quite by accident, I discovered a wonderfully effective treatment- frozen cubes of aloe-vera "goo" and lavender! All are anti-inflammatory. Just place the cube on the sore area and let it melt. The relief is sublime :) :)

Here's the recipe:

Take two (or more) stalks from an aloe vera plant (take from the outer layers, they are more mature), and slice off the skins with a knife. Be careful, because the goo inside is very slippery. In a bowl, add together all the clear aloe-goo, a few tsps of dried lavender and about 16 drops of lavender oil. Put everything in a blender and whizz until smooth and slightly frothy. Then pour into an ice tray, freeze, and use as needed. I tried it three hours ago, and haven't had any hint of pain since.... I feel like a different person!!!
